John Piper, Reformed pastor and theologian known for preaching and writing on Christian spirituality, explores Romans 12:2–8 and the renewed mind. He contrasts worldly self-views with sober judgment. He explains measuring ourselves by faith, how faith turns self-reflection toward Christ, and how serving in the church uncovers and shapes spiritual gifts.

Measure Yourself By Faith In Christ
- A renewed mind measures self by faith, not by worldly success or self-appraisal.
- Faith looks away from self to Christ and makes Christ the criterion of worth and significance.
Faith Turns Self-Reflection Into Christ-Seeing
- Faith functions as a window: looking at self through faith reveals Christ on the other side.
- Our worth, value, and esteem are found by treasuring Christ, not by inflating self-regard.
Faith As A Gift That Kills Boasting
- Faith is a gift from God and therefore destroys grounds for boasting about spiritual insight.
- Measuring by faith both humbles us and prevents pride because our faith itself is received, not achieved.
